Well, I'd rather we actually did the same thing elsewhere too.
Consistency here is valuable wherever we can achieve it.

I was surprised to learn we can use GPT on IBM Z, so it's being
explored to support it in kiwi:
https://github.com/OSInside/kiwi/issues/2694

We already use GPT for x86_64 and Power systems. ARM is the fiddly one
because ARM systems kind of suck in terms of platform coherence.

I'm also thinking ahead a bit with RISC-V to figure out if we're going
to have problems here too. I don't think we will, but who knows...?
